From 69068584f9ed68b8b2736287a1c9863e11b741d5 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: Mariusz Tkaczyk <mariusz.tkaczyk@linux.intel.com>
Date: Fri, 11 Dec 2020 12:28:38 +0100
Subject: [PATCH 1/2] Incremental: Remove redundant spare movement logic
Git-commit: 69068584f9ed68b8b2736287a1c9863e11b741d5
References: jsc#SLE-13700, bsc#1180220
If policy is set then mdmonitor is responsible for moving spares.
This logic is reduntant and potentialy dangerus, spare could be moved at
initrd stage depending on drives appearance order.
Remove it.
Signed-off-by: Mariusz Tkaczyk <mariusz.tkaczyk@linux.intel.com>
Signed-off-by: Jes Sorensen <jsorensen@fb.com>
Signed-off-by: Coly Li <colyli@suse.de>
---
Incremental.c | 62 ---------------------------------------------------
1 file changed, 62 deletions(-)

From 75562b57d43bd252399b55d0004b8eac4b337a67 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: Lidong Zhong <lidong.zhong@suse.com>
Date: Mon, 14 Dec 2020 22:51:33 +0800
Subject: [PATCH 2/2] Dump: get stat from a wrong metadata file when restoring
metadata
Git-commit: 75562b57d43bd252399b55d0004b8eac4b337a67
References: jsc#SLE-13700
The dumped metadata files are shown as below
localhost:~ # ll -ih test/
total 16K
34565564 -rw-r--r-- 2 root root 1.0G Dec 14 21:15
scsi-0QEMU_QEMU_HARDDISK_drive-scsi0-0-0-3
34565563 -rw-r--r-- 2 root root 1.0G Dec 14 21:15
scsi-0QEMU_QEMU_HARDDISK_drive-scsi0-0-0-4
34565563 -rw-r--r-- 2 root root 1.0G Dec 14 21:15 sda
34565564 -rw-r--r-- 2 root root 1.0G Dec 14 21:15 sdb
It reports such error when trying to restore metadata for /dev/sda
localhost:~ # mdadm --restore=test /dev/sda
Mdadm: test/scsi-0QEMU_QEMU_HARDDISK_drive-scsi0-0-0-4 is not the same
size as /dev/sda - cannot restore.
It's because the stb value has been changed to other metadata file in
the while statement.
